What is Stone Barn Brandyworks?

Stone Barn Brandyworks
ManufacturingFood & BeverageRetail

Stone Barn Brandyworks is a distinguished distillery rooted in Portland, Oregon, dedicated to the art of craft spirits. Their product portfolio prominently features regional fruit brandies, sophisticated brandy-based liqueurs, and artisanal rye whiskeys. A core tenet of their operation is the commitment to sourcing local and organic ingredients, ensuring that each spirit authentically embodies the unique terroir of the Pacific Northwest. The distillery's offerings are diverse, including seasonal specialties like strawberry liqueur and apricot brandy, alongside providing valuable contract distilling services to wineries. Through community engagement via events and farmers markets, Stone Barn Brandyworks strives to make its premium spirits accessible and appreciated by a broad clientele.
